IBM Support

IZ29231: OMNIBUS_TEC.RLS UPDATE_OMNIBUS_EVENTS RULE DOES NOT CLOSE EVENT

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• Problem Description:  OMNIbus_tec.rls update_omnibus_events rule
    does not close event
    Failing TEC Component(s): rule
    Customer/Recreate Environment:
    
    Database:  N/A
    TME Framework:  N/A
    Install Method:  upgrade
    TEC Server:  3.9 FP07
    Tec Gateway:  N/A
    Tec UI Server:  N/A
    WAS server:  N/A
    Tec Console:  N/A
    Endpoints:  N/A
    TMR/TEC same machine: Yes
    Affected Locale(s):  N/A
       Collected Information:
    rulebase, rules.trace and wtdumprl containing events in ecurep
    under 02940,353,758.
    Also put there the OMNIbus_tec.rls;  omni.event.txt which is the
    first omnibus event.
    omni_update.event.txt - second omnibus events that clears the
    first event.
    
    
    Last Known Good Level:  N/A
    L3 Acknowledged:  KB
    
    Recreate Steps:
    1. Either use rulebase provided, or add OMNIbus.baroc and
    OMNIbus_tec.rls to a rulebase.
    2. Use the event tests above to send the two events, the event
    severity is changed but the event is not closed.
    
    Problem Details and troubleshooting:
     OMNIbus_tec.rls update_omnibus_events rule does not close event
    When a clearing event arrives to the Omnibus Server it sends an
    OMNIbus_Update event to the TEC Server,
    this activates the update_omnibus_events rule, however only the
    first part of the rule activates.
    
    This has already been looked at by Level 3 who state:
    What the update_omnibus_severity reception action essentially
    does is:
    
    IF update event severity differs from original event severity
    THEN change the severity of the original, and update the
    administrator
    ELSE
       TRUE and
          IF omni status is OPEN, THEN change the status to OPEN
          IF omni status is ACK, THEN change the status to ACK
          IF omni status is CLEARED, THEN change the status to
    CLOSED
    
    So, the status does not get changed, because the ELSE block is
    not
    entered.
    
    Rule needs to be changed so that all actions are carried out.
    

Local fix

Problem summary

  • When an OMNIbus_Update event is forwarded to TEC, in which
    both the severity and status are changed, only the severity
    is changed for the corresponding TEC event.
    

Problem conclusion

  • The TEC rule was corrected in order that the severity and
    status be updated in the case of receiving an OMNIbus_Update
    with both a severity and status change.
    
    The update is available in the 4.0 version of
    TEC_OMNIbus_IntegrationFlows.tar.
    

Temporary fix

Comments

APAR Information

  • APAR number

    IZ29231

  • Reported component name

    TIVOLI ENT.CONS

  • Reported component ID

    5698TEC00

  • Reported release

    390

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t

  • Submitted date

    2008-08-08

  • Closed date

    2008-10-17

  • Last modified date

    2008-10-17

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

Fix information

  • Fixed component name

    TIVOLI ENT.CONS

  • Fixed component ID

    5698TEC00

Applicable component levels

  • R390 PSY

       UP

[{"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Product":{"code":"SSGMKC","label":"Tivoli Enterprise Console"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"390","Edition":"","Line of Business":{"code":"LOB45","label":"Automation"}}]

Document Information

Modified date:
17 October 2008